Omophoita marianna Bechyne 1958

Abstract

Published as part of Begha, Bruno Piotrovski, Anjos, Camila Alves Dos, Santos, Mateus Henrique & Prado, Laura Rocha, 2023, Checklist of Omophoita Chevrolat, 1836 (Coleoptera: Chrysomelidae: Galerucinae: Alticini) and diagnoses for some species from southern Brazil: notes on the taxonomic history, redescriptions and new records, pp. 375-397 in Zootaxa 5357 (3) on page 381, DOI: 10.11646/zootaxa.5357.3.3, http://zenodo.org/record/10061420

Omophoita marianna Bechyné, 1958a: 674 Distr.: Brazil — Rio de Janeiro. Refs.: Bechyné & Bechyné 1971: 289 (as Asphaerasta nomen nudum); Seeno et al. 1976: 32.
